Prix de West is the nation’s premier Western art exhibition and sale …At noon on September 16, 1893 the 6,361,000 acres of the Cherokee Outlet was opened to settlement by means of the fourth land run. Congress had purchased the Cherokee land for $8,505,736 or about $1.40 per acre. National Cowboy & Western Heritage Museum. 1700 Northeast 63rd St. Oklahoma City, OK 73111 Founded in 1955, the museum displays a thoughtfully curated collection of Western art and artifacts, as well as interactive galleries centered on the American …In 1967 the National Cowboy Hall of Fame (now National Cowboy and Western Heritage Museum) in Oklahoma City acquired Fraser's studio collection. In 1968 Dean Krakel, the museum's director, traveled to California to acquire the plasterwork. National Cowboy & Western Heritage Museum. 1700 Northeast 63rd St. Oklahoma City, OK 73111 (405) 478-2250 About The Museum; Facility Rentals; Blog; Careers; …Located on Persimmon Hill in Oklahoma City, the National Cowboy & Western Heritage Museum encompasses more than 200,000 square feet of space and features over 28,000 Western and American Indian art works and artifacts.
